If you've arrived at jslg-my.sharepoint.com, you're looking at a Microsoft SharePoint site that requires a login. That redirect to Microsoft's authentication page is standard behavior for any SharePoint tenant, not a sign of anything shady.
What matters is that the underlying infrastructure is unmistakably Microsoft. The site resolves to Microsoft-owned IP addresses, uses a valid certificate, and enforces modern security protections. There are no blacklist reports or Google Web Risk flags. This isn't some random domain pretending to be something it's not — it's a genuine part of the Microsoft 365 ecosystem.
For anyone asking "is jslg-my.sharepoint.com a scam?": the evidence says no. It's a normal SharePoint login page. If you're a user of this tenant, proceed as you would with any corporate SharePoint site. Just be sure you're on the real login page and not a lookalike — check the URL starts with https://jslg-my.sharepoint.com before entering credentials.
